Arriving at Lourdes: The Heart of the Experience

Once in Lourdes, the focus shifts to exploring the sanctuary complex. You’ll visit the main basilicas, walk around the grounds, and have time to attend the principal mass—an experience many travelers find profoundly meaningful. The basilica’s architecture is impressive, and the atmosphere is peaceful, especially if you choose to spend time in prayer or reflection.

The highlight for many is visiting the famous cave where Bernadette Soubirous experienced her visions. You’ll be able to see the Grotto de Massabielle, where the Marian apparitions appeared, and maybe even fill a small bottle with spring water believed to have healing properties. Visiting Bernadette’s House

No trip to Lourdes would be complete without seeing Bernadette’s humble residence. The house provides an authentic glimpse into her simple life and the origins of the Marian apparitions. It’s a quieter spot, ideal for those who want to step back from the busier pilgrimage areas and absorb a bit of history.
